
Philanthropic Guarantors
The cornerstone of our model is our philanthropic guarantors. These guarantors are high-net-worth individuals, foundations and other organizations that support Xseed Impact’s mission. Philanthropic loan guarantees are an extremely efficient way for these supporters to maximize the the impact of their generosity. Guarantors take on a portion of the risk of a default in our portfolio of loans to social enterprises. This allows Xseed Impact to access affordable and flexible financing, then pass on these savings to borrowers in developing countries. By taking on a portion of the risk, philanthropic guarantors unlock significant capital for international development.
Lenders
With the backing of philanthropic guarantees, Xseed Impact borrows from banks, credit unions and other financial institutions to fund its investments. These lenders partner with us because of their support for Xseed Impact’s mission, the financial sustainability of our operations and their confidence in the philanthropic guarantee model.
Borrowing Organizations
We provide debt financing to social enterprises and other organizations that improve the livelihoods of low-income and underserved people, particularly women, in developing countries. These investments are in the areas of financial inclusion, small business development, agri-food/agroforestry and climate technology. Xseed Impact lends to organizations across Africa, Asia and Latin America. All borrowing organizations pass our triple-bottom-line due diligence process, looking at their social, environmental and financial performance.
Social and Environmental Objectives
Our investment program is built around the ultimate objectives of:
- Reducing the number of people living in poverty
- Increasing food security
- Greater gender equality
- Increasing productive employment and decent work
- Reducing the effects of climate change and increasing resilience to its consequences
We set targets for each investment that further these objectives and monitor results to maximize impact.
